""" Per-request thread-local data. """ import threading import locale import gettext from base import ReadOnly, lock from constants import OVERRIDE_ERROR, CALLABLE_ERROR # Thread-local storage of most per-request information context = threading.local() class Connection(ReadOnly): """ Base class for connection objects stored on `request.context`. """ def __init__(self, conn, disconnect): self.conn = conn if not callable(disconnect): raise TypeError( CALLABLE_ERROR % ('disconnect', disconnect, type(disconnect)) ) self.disconnect = disconnect lock(self) def destroy_context(): """ Delete all attributes on thread-local `request.context`. """ # need to use .values(), 'cos value.disconnect modifies the dict for value in context.__dict__.values(): if isinstance(value, Connection): value.disconnect() context.__dict__.clear() def ugettext(message): if hasattr(context, 'ugettext'): return context.ugettext(message) return message.decode('UTF-8') def ungettext(singular, plural, n): if hasattr(context, 'ungettext'): return context.ungettext(singular, plural, n) if n == 1: return singular.decode('UTF-8') return plural.decode('UTF-8') def set_languages(*languages): if hasattr(context, 'languages'): raise StandardError(OVERRIDE_ERROR % ('context', 'languages', context.languages, languages) ) if len(languages) == 0: languages = locale.getdefaultlocale()[:1] context.languages = languages assert type(context.languages) is tuple def create_translation(domain, localedir, *languages): if hasattr(context, 'ugettext') or hasattr(context, 'ungettext'): raise StandardError( 'create_translation() already called in thread %r' % threading.currentThread().getName() ) set_languages(*languages) translation = gettext.translation(domain, localedir=localedir, languages=context.languages, fallback=True ) context.ugettext = translation.ugettext context.ungettext = translation.ungettext
